Omega-3s
Research has shown that omega-3s can help to reduce inflammation in the body, which can lead to a healthier complexion. Inflammation is a natural response to injury or infection, but when it becomes chronic, it can cause damage to the skin and accelerate the aging process. Omega-3s can help to counteract this process by reducing inflammation and promoting the growth of healthy new skin cells. Omega-3s also help to moisturize the skin from the inside out. They help to maintain the skin’s natural barrier function, which keeps moisture in and irritants out. This can help to prevent dryness, flakiness, and other skin problems that can occur when the skin becomes dehydrated.
Zinc
Research has suggested that zinc can help improve a variety of skin conditions, including acne, eczema, and psoriasis. In fact, studies have shown that people with acne tend to have lower levels of zinc in their bloodstream than those without acne. Zinc supplements or topical treatments containing zinc may help reduce the severity of these conditions. However, it’s important to note that too much zinc can be harmful. The recommended daily intake of zinc for adults is 8-11 mg per day. Consuming more than this amount can lead to n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ea. Therefore, it’s crucial to speak with a healthcare professional before taking any supplements or making significant changes to your diet.
